Why It Matters

By cutting fees over 90%, Hyperliquid aims to accelerate the launch and adoption of novel perpetual markets, potentially expanding its ecosystem and increasing on‑chain trading volume in a competitive DeFi landscape.

Summary

Hyperliquid announced a "growth mode" upgrade for its HIP‑3 perpetual futures system, slashing taker fees from the standard 0.045% to as low as 0.00144%‑0.009% for new permissionless markets. The fee reductions, which also apply to rebates and volume contributions, are intended to attract early liquidity and trading activity to markets that are not duplicates of existing validator‑operated perps. Growth mode can be enabled by deployers who stake at least 500,000 HYPE tokens, but markets must be distinct from existing assets and are subject to a 30‑day cool‑down and validator oversight. Hyperliquid’s TVL sits above $4.2 billion, while its HYPE token trades around $37.30.
